P. Denes is a scholar working on Artificial Intelligence, Signal Processing and Experimental and Cognitive Psychology. According to data from OpenAlex, P. Denes has authored 36 papers receiving a total of 946 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 15 papers in Artificial Intelligence, 11 papers in Signal Processing and 8 papers in Experimental and Cognitive Psychology. Recurrent topics in P. Denes's work include Speech Recognition and Synthesis (13 papers), Speech and Audio Processing (11 papers) and Phonetics and Phonology Research (8 papers). P. Denes is often cited by papers focused on Speech Recognition and Synthesis (13 papers), Speech and Audio Processing (11 papers) and Phonetics and Phonology Research (8 papers). P. Denes collaborates with scholars based in United Kingdom, Australia and Japan. P. Denes's co-authors include Elliot N. Pinson, Edward E. David, M. V. Mathews, D. Β. Fry, H. Kalmus, R. H. Bolt, Kenneth N. Stevens, Ralph F. Naunton, Franklin S. Cooper and John D. O’Connor and has published in prestigious journals such as Nature, Science and The Lancet.
